Output ebec95453b3c1af85f925dac4055d4ef38762526f6ea8dfc588420f155f0c39f:0

value
705999
script pubkey
OP_0 OP_PUSHBYTES_20 d64c7727b359420b27cb20f71ea00bf25e30da91
address
bc1q6ex8wfant9pqkf7tyrm3agqt7f0rpk53dpsfhp
transaction
ebec95453b3c1af85f925dac4055d4ef38762526f6ea8dfc588420f155f0c39f
spent
true